diff options
| author | Chris Lu <chris.lu@gmail.com> | 2012-09-01 13:17:30 -0700 |
|---|---|---|
| committer | Chris Lu <chris.lu@gmail.com> | 2012-09-01 13:17:30 -0700 |
| commit | a467d5081ceedc4f2659987438d7e9a0dcddf079 (patch) | |
| tree | 1eea79f8488fe895799ace61c4fc5c929807a921 | |
| parent | c51884ce23b3c32dbef4af474c480e69797848c2 (diff) | |
| download | seaweedfs-a467d5081ceedc4f2659987438d7e9a0dcddf079.tar.xz seaweedfs-a467d5081ceedc4f2659987438d7e9a0dcddf079.zip | |
adjusted tests
| -rw-r--r-- | weed-fs/src/pkg/topology/topo_test.go | 6 | ||||
| -rw-r--r-- | weed-fs/src/pkg/topology/topology.go | 3 |
2 files changed, 3 insertions, 6 deletions
diff --git a/weed-fs/src/pkg/topology/topo_test.go b/weed-fs/src/pkg/topology/topo_test.go index 928454791..5bbc33dd9 100644 --- a/weed-fs/src/pkg/topology/topo_test.go +++ b/weed-fs/src/pkg/topology/topo_test.go @@ -161,11 +161,9 @@ func TestRemoveDataCenter(t *testing.T) { func TestReserveOneVolume(t *testing.T) { topo := setup() rand.Seed(time.Now().UnixNano()) - ret, vid := topo.RandomlyReserveOneVolume() + ret, node, vid := topo.RandomlyReserveOneVolume() fmt.Println("topology:", topo.Node) fmt.Println("assigned :", ret) + fmt.Println("assigned node :", node) fmt.Println("assigned volume id:", vid) - if topo.reservedVolumeCount != 1 { - t.Fail() - } } diff --git a/weed-fs/src/pkg/topology/topology.go b/weed-fs/src/pkg/topology/topology.go index ce313dc7b..79f0fac67 100644 --- a/weed-fs/src/pkg/topology/topology.go +++ b/weed-fs/src/pkg/topology/topology.go @@ -3,7 +3,7 @@ package topology import ( "math/rand" "pkg/storage" - "fmt" + _ "fmt" ) type Topology struct { @@ -19,7 +19,6 @@ func NewTopology(id NodeId) *Topology{ func (t *Topology) RandomlyReserveOneVolume() (bool, *Node, storage.VolumeId) { slots := t.Node.maxVolumeCount-t.Node.activeVolumeCount r := rand.Intn(slots) - fmt.Println("slots:", slots, "random :", r) vid := t.nextVolumeId() ret, node := t.Node.ReserveOneVolume(r,vid) return ret, node, vid |
